Skip to main content

10 Java Resume Samples That Will Get You Hired

10 Java Resume Samples That Will Get You Hired

Overview

The article “10 Java Resume Samples That Will Get You Hired” provides diverse resume examples tailored to different experience levels, emphasizing essential skills and qualifications that enhance employability in the Java programming field. Each sample highlights specific attributes, such as technical expertise, leadership experience, and relevant certifications, which are crucial for standing out to employers in a competitive job market, as well as strategies for optimizing resumes to pass Applicant Tracking Systems (ATS).

Introduction

In the competitive landscape of technology, a well-crafted resume can be the key to unlocking career opportunities for Java developers at every experience level. As the demand for skilled professionals continues to rise, understanding how to effectively showcase one’s qualifications is paramount.

From entry-level candidates eager to demonstrate foundational skills to seasoned experts highlighting leadership and advanced technical proficiencies, each resume must be tailored to reflect unique experiences and industry expectations.

This article delves into:

  • Diverse resume samples
  • Essential skills
  • Formatting strategies

These elements not only enhance visibility in the job market but also align with the evolving needs of employers. By leveraging these insights, Java developers can position themselves for success in a dynamic and rapidly changing field.

Diverse Java Resume Samples for Every Experience Level

  1. Entry-Level Programming Developer Resume: This java resume sample highlights fundamental abilities such as programming in Java, object-oriented design, relevant coursework, and internships that demonstrate adaptability and a desire to learn. Such qualities are attractive to employers seeking potential over extensive experience, particularly as many companies prioritize nurturing new talent in a competitive landscape. Essential certifications like Oracle Certified Associate (OCA) can enhance employability in this role. Techneeds provides resources to help individuals in recognizing these crucial abilities and certifications required for success.
  2. Java Resume Sample for a Mid-Level Java Developer: This example balances technical expertise in frameworks like Spring and Hibernate with project management experience, demonstrating the candidate’s capability to lead teams and deliver complex projects on schedule. Given that most developers report an average salary range of $60K to $75K, which is $10K less than last year, effective communication of these skills can significantly impact salary negotiations. Techneeds offers insights on industry standards and job matching to enhance these discussions, along with crafting support tailored to highlight these competencies.
  3. Java Resume Sample for a Senior Java Developer: This resume emphasizes leadership positions, successful project results, and advanced technical skills in areas such as microservices architecture and cloud technologies, positioning the individual as a strategic thinker in software development. Such resumes are crucial as the tech industry continues to support high compensation levels despite recent challenges. Techneeds collaborates with employers to ensure applicants are aware of changing market demands and provides coaching on how to showcase their accomplishments effectively.
  4. Software Engineer Resume: This example highlights coding expertise in programming languages such as Python, contributions to open-source projects, and collaboration within agile environments, showcasing a well-rounded set of abilities. Employers increasingly value engineers who can not only code but also drive innovation through collaboration. Techneeds motivates individuals to highlight their teamwork experiences in their profiles and offers advice on effective presentation.
  5. Developer with Cybersecurity Focus: This resume demonstrates specialized expertise in cybersecurity, such as understanding of secure coding practices and familiarity with tools like OWASP ZAP, showcasing how the individual’s unique qualifications can enhance security measures within tech firms. As cybersecurity becomes increasingly critical, such expertise is in high demand. Techneeds offers targeted job alerts for security-focused roles and resources to highlight these skills.
  6. Freelance Programming Developer Resume: This example illustrates how to showcase a varied portfolio of projects, highlighting adaptability and a wide range of expertise that meets the needs of different clients. Freelancers must effectively communicate their outcomes; as noted by Stratoflow, ‘They’ve been able to deliver all of their work on time and within budget, which has been very impressive.’ Techneeds provides resources to enhance freelance visibility and success, including tips on showcasing client feedback and project impacts.
  7. Software Developer Transitioning from Another Field: This example adeptly leverages transferable skills from a different industry, such as problem-solving and analytical thinking, making a compelling case for the individual’s fit in the tech sector. Highlighting relevant experiences can help bridge the gap for those entering the tech field from other domains. Techneeds assists individuals through coaching and workshop sessions aimed at highlighting transferable skills.
  8. Software Developer with Certifications: This resume highlights pertinent certifications such as Oracle Certified Professional (OCP) and continuous training in new technologies, demonstrating the individual’s dedication to professional growth. Certifications can significantly enhance employability, especially in a rapidly evolving industry. Techneeds provides insights into valuable certifications and training opportunities, ensuring individuals are well-prepared.
  9. Remote Software Developer Resume: This example highlights abilities for remote work, such as effective communication, self-management, and familiarity with remote collaboration tools, appealing to companies with distributed teams. The ability to thrive in a remote environment is increasingly sought after in today’s job market. Techneeds links individuals with remote job opportunities customized to their abilities and offers resources to improve remote work preparedness.
  10. Java Developer CV for a Specific Industry: This java resume sample is tailored to a particular sector, such as finance or healthcare, showcasing industry-specific knowledge and experience. Tailoring applications in this manner can assist individuals in distinguishing themselves in specialized markets, matching their abilities with particular employer requirements. With the current tech industry near all-time highs in compensation and job availability, individuals should leverage their unique qualifications, and Techneeds is here to support that journey with tailored resume assistance and industry insights.

Key Elements That Make Java Resumes Stand Out

  1. Tailored Summary Statement: Crafting a compelling summary statement that aligns directly with the job description is crucial for capturing attention. This section should encompass the applicant’s career ambitions and emphasize the abilities that are most pertinent to the position, ensuring it resonates with hiring managers. Additionally, as employers increasingly value soft skills such as adaptability and creativity, reflecting these traits in the summary can further enhance its impact.
  2. Quantifiable Achievements: Incorporating quantifiable metrics such as ‘increased application performance by 30%’ serves as powerful evidence of an applicant’s past successes. The use of specific data not only enhances the document’s persuasiveness but also distinguishes the applicant in a competitive job market. It is noteworthy that up to 72% of applicants admit to embellishing their experiences, making honesty and transparency essential in presenting achievements.
  3. Relevant Keywords: Strategically utilizing keywords extracted from the job posting is essential. This practice not only ensures that the resume aligns with the expectations of hiring managers but also enhances compatibility with Applicant Tracking Systems (ATS), increasing the chances of making it through initial screenings.
  4. Technical Expertise Section: A clearly defined technical expertise section that lists relevant programming languages, frameworks, and tools, such as those found in a java resume sample, pertinent to Java development allows hiring managers to quickly assess the candidate’s qualifications. This clarity is crucial, particularly as employers increasingly prioritize adaptability and specific competencies over traditional qualifications.
  5. Professional Experience: Highlighting relevant work experience is fundamental. Candidates should detail their responsibilities and the achievements that demonstrate their qualifications. This not only showcases their expertise but also illustrates their capacity to contribute effectively to prospective employers. Incorporating personal projects can also be advantageous, as Glassdoor indicates that 82% of applications lack side projects, which can showcase skills and initiative.
  6. Education and Certifications: It is important to emphasize the educational background, including relevant certifications such as Oracle Certified Professional. These elements lend credibility to the candidate’s profile and reflect a commitment to continuous professional development in a rapidly evolving field. Given that over 40% of recruiters are deterred by resumes with excessive design elements, maintaining simplicity and readability while presenting this information is paramount.

Each branch represents a key element of a Java resume, with sub-branches providing detailed advice and examples related to each element.

Highlighting Essential Skills and Qualifications for Java Developers

  1. Proficiency in the language: A robust understanding of fundamentals, particularly key object-oriented programming (OOP) concepts such as inheritance, polymorphism, abstraction, and encapsulation, is vital for any developer of this technology. This foundational knowledge enables developers to design scalable and efficient systems, which is especially important in industries like finance, where firms such as JPMorgan Chase utilize a programming language for their trading and risk management systems. Reports indicate that JPMorgan Chase relies heavily on the programming language to build these critical applications, underscoring the importance of proficiency in this sector.
  2. Frameworks and Libraries: Familiarity with leading frameworks and libraries is essential for modern programming development. Proficiency in tools such as Spring, Hibernate, and JavaServer Faces allows developers to build robust applications that meet modern enterprise needs. In 2024, expertise in frameworks like Spring Boot, Apache Maven, and JavaFX will be particularly in demand, reflecting the industry’s shift towards more sophisticated programming environments. Comprehending these frameworks is vital for developers aiming to improve their employability in a competitive job market.
  3. Database Management: Knowledge of SQL and experience with relational databases, including MySQL and PostgreSQL, are crucial for backend development. Understanding how to manage and interact with databases enhances a developer’s ability to create full-stack applications, ensuring seamless data integration and retrieval.
  4. Version Control Systems: Proficiency in version control systems, particularly Git, is necessary for collaborative development. Developers must demonstrate their ability to work effectively within a team, managing code changes and maintaining project integrity through structured workflows.
  5. Problem-Solving Skills: Strong analytical and problem-solving abilities are indispensable for debugging and optimizing applications. Developers must be equipped to tackle complex issues that arise during the software development lifecycle, ensuring timely delivery and functionality.
  6. Agile Methodologies: Experience with Agile practices showcases a developer’s adaptability and teamwork in fast-paced environments. Understanding Agile methodologies promotes effective collaboration and iterative progress, which are critical in today’s dynamic tech landscape. As the industry evolves, these skills will remain crucial for developers aiming to thrive in team-oriented settings.
  7. For Java developers, familiarity with build tools such as Ant and Maven is essential to include in a java resume sample. These tools automate tasks from compilation to testing, significantly enhancing development efficiency. Understanding how to effectively utilize these tools is critical for streamlining the development process and ensuring high-quality code, which is essential to include in a java resume sample.

Formatting Your Java Resume for Maximum Impact

  1. Consistent Formatting: Adopting a uniform font, size, and style throughout the document is crucial for creating a polished and professional appearance. Consistency not only reflects attention to detail but also aids readability, which is paramount in capturing a hiring manager’s interest.
  2. Clear Section Headings: Utilizing bold headings to clearly delineate sections significantly enhances navigation for hiring managers. This organization enables recruiters to swiftly find pertinent information, enhancing the chances of your application making a positive impression. Research shows that clear section headings can lead to better engagement from hiring managers, making it vital to structure your resume effectively.
  3. Bullet Points for Clarity: Employing bullet points to present information succinctly is a best practice that enhances readability. This format enables key achievements and abilities to stand out, ensuring that hiring managers can quickly evaluate your qualifications. Notably, 91% of recruiters appreciate seeing soft skills highlighted in this manner, underscoring the importance of clarity in communication.
  4. White Space Utilization: Adequate white space is essential for avoiding clutter and creating a visually appealing document. This design principle not only improves aesthetics but also aids in readability, making it easier for hiring managers to digest the information presented. A Zippia survey found that over 40% of recruiters are deterred by applications with excessive design elements, emphasizing the need for simplicity and readability.
  5. Length Consideration: Limiting the document to one or two pages is vital, focusing on the most relevant information to prevent overwhelming the reader. Research indicates that overly lengthy summaries can deter recruiters in 29% of cases. Thus, a concise summary of around 15 words effectively grabs the attention of hiring managers while keeping your qualifications at the forefront. Additionally, it’s noteworthy that only 48% of applications include a link to a LinkedIn profile, which can enhance professionalism and completeness.

Each box represents a best practice for resume formatting, and the arrows indicate the recommended sequence to follow.

Optimizing Your Java Resume to Beat the ATS

  1. Use Standard Job Titles: Aligning your job titles with those commonly recognized in the industry is crucial for ensuring that [Applicant Tracking Systems](https://jobs.techneeds.com/jobs-in/North Andover/MA) (ATS) can accurately categorize your application. This simple adjustment can significantly improve your chances of being noticed by human recruiters. According to research, applications optimized for ATS are more likely to be reviewed by human recruiters, increasing your interview opportunities.
  2. Incorporate Keywords: Strategically placing relevant keywords throughout your document, especially in the skills and experience sections, enhances ATS compatibility. This practice not only aligns your application with the job description but also boosts your visibility in applicant searches. As Michelle Dumas, founder and CEO of Distinctive Career Services, states, “You don’t need to choose one over the other since almost all companies, including Fortune 500s and recruiting firms, use ATS to track candidates.”
  3. Avoid Complex Formatting: It’s essential to stick to straightforward formatting. Complex designs, images, or unusual fonts can hinder ATS readability, which might result in your application being overlooked. A clean, simple layout ensures that your qualifications are effectively communicated.
  4. Save in the Right Format: Submitting your curriculum vitae in formats like .docx or PDF is advisable, as these are typically compatible with ATS. This choice maximizes the likelihood that your application will be processed correctly and reviewed by hiring managers.
  5. Include a Skills Section: A dedicated skills section is vital for capturing all relevant competencies. This not only aids ATS in identifying your qualifications but also highlights your suitability for the position, enhancing your chances of passing the initial screening. Investing time in optimizing your resume can lead to better job application outcomes, as evidenced by the case study titled “The Value of Optimizing Your Resume,” which demonstrates that optimizing a resume increases the chances of receiving interview invitations, making the effort worthwhile.

Conclusion

In the realm of Java development, a standout resume is essential for navigating the competitive job market and securing desirable positions. This article has highlighted key strategies for crafting effective resumes tailored to various experience levels, from entry-level candidates to seasoned professionals. By utilizing diverse resume samples, developers can better understand how to showcase their skills and experiences in a compelling manner.

The importance of essential skills cannot be overstated, as proficiency in Java and familiarity with relevant frameworks, databases, and methodologies are critical for success in this field. Moreover, the strategic inclusion of quantifiable achievements and relevant keywords significantly enhances the visibility of a resume, ensuring it resonates with hiring managers and aligns with Applicant Tracking Systems (ATS).

Finally, adopting effective formatting strategies can make a substantial difference in how a resume is perceived. Consistent formatting, clear section headings, and the thoughtful use of white space contribute to a polished and professional appearance, which is crucial for capturing attention in a crowded applicant pool.

In conclusion, by leveraging the insights provided, Java developers can position themselves for success, enhancing their employability and standing out to potential employers. A well-crafted resume, reflective of both technical expertise and personal achievements, serves as a powerful tool in achieving career aspirations within this dynamic industry.

Frequently Asked Questions

What should be included in an entry-level programming developer resume?

An entry-level programming developer resume should highlight fundamental abilities such as programming in Java, object-oriented design, relevant coursework, and internships. Essential certifications like Oracle Certified Associate (OCA) can also enhance employability.

What are key features of a mid-level Java developer resume?

A mid-level Java developer resume should balance technical expertise in frameworks like Spring and Hibernate with project management experience. This demonstrates the candidate’s capability to lead teams and deliver complex projects on schedule.

What should a senior Java developer resume emphasize?

A senior Java developer resume should emphasize leadership positions, successful project results, and advanced technical skills in areas such as microservices architecture and cloud technologies, showcasing the individual as a strategic thinker in software development.

What skills are important for a software engineer resume?

A software engineer resume should highlight coding expertise in programming languages like Python, contributions to open-source projects, and collaboration within agile environments. Employers value engineers who can drive innovation through teamwork.

What qualifications should a cybersecurity-focused developer highlight in their resume?

A developer with a cybersecurity focus should showcase specialized expertise in secure coding practices and familiarity with tools like OWASP ZAP. This expertise is increasingly in demand as cybersecurity becomes critical.

How should a freelance programming developer resume be structured?

A freelance programming developer resume should illustrate a varied portfolio of projects, highlighting adaptability and a wide range of expertise. Effective communication of outcomes is essential for freelancers to attract clients.

How can a software developer transitioning from another field present their skills?

A software developer transitioning from another field should leverage transferable skills such as problem-solving and analytical thinking to make a compelling case for their fit in the tech sector. Highlighting relevant experiences is key.

Why are certifications important for software developers?

Certifications, such as Oracle Certified Professional (OCP), are important as they demonstrate a commitment to professional growth and can significantly enhance employability in a rapidly evolving industry.

What should a remote software developer resume highlight?

A remote software developer resume should highlight abilities for remote work, including effective communication, self-management, and familiarity with remote collaboration tools, which are increasingly sought after in the job market.

How can a Java developer tailor their resume for a specific industry?

A Java developer can tailor their resume for a specific industry, such as finance or healthcare, by showcasing industry-specific knowledge and experience. This helps distinguish themselves in specialized markets.